Warning Signs You Need Office Building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to bigger problems and more costly repairs. Don’t wait, call us today to address any of these issues.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a musty smell in your office, it could be a sign of water damage or mold growth. Our team will identify the source and provide a solution to remove the odor.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

If your flooring is warped or buckled, it may be a sign of water damage. Our team will assess the damage and provide a solution to repair or replace the flooring.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ains on walls or ceilings can be a sign of water damage or leaks. Our team will identify the source and provide a solution to repair or replace the affected area.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or moisture issues. Our team will assess the damage and provide a solution to repair or replace the affected area.

Discolored or Faded Carpeting

Discolored or faded carpeting can be a sign of water damage or moisture issues. Our team will assess the damage and provide a solution to repair or replace the carpeting.

Standing Water or Leaks

Standing water or leaks can cause significant damage to your office. Our team will respond quickly to reduce the damage and prevent further issues.

Office Building Water Damage Restoration Cost in Mountain Home AFB, ID

The cost of office building water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Mountain Home AFB, ID.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and equipment needed
Cleaning and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and type of cleaning products used
Repair and re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Scope of repairs and materials needed
Final inspection and touch-ups $100 – $500 Complexity of repairs and time required
Mold remediation $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and type of mold present
Equipment repair or replacement $500 – $5,000 Complexity of repairs and equipment needed
